As I leave the role of Chair of DAW, I would like to take this opportunity to thank all members and friends for the support I received since taking on the role of Chair in 2012. 

 

I have met some wonderful people along the way, enjoyed some excellent Regional Festivals, Wales and British Finals, learned so much at our Summer Schools thanks to our Vice Chair, Sue Jones for organising them, and made lots of new friends.  It hasn't been easy, but then no one expected it to be; what it has been is very special. 

 

I was even fortunate enough to chair DAW's hosting of the British Final Festival of One-Act Plays at The Sherman Theatre, Cardiff in July 2016 which was won by The Unknown OUTCasts from Cardiff. The first time Wales have won in 24 years. What an amazing night that was and what a memory it has left me with!
